ホームページ >バックエンド開発 >Python チュートリアル >Pythonの正弦曲線実装方法の解析
この記事では主に、数値演算用の numpy モジュールとグラフィックス描画用の matplotlib.pyplot モジュールを使用した Python の関連操作スキルを含む、Python グラフィック描画操作の正弦曲線実装方法を紹介します。それはすべての人を助けることができます。
正弦曲線を描くには、まず x の値の範囲を 0 ~ 2π に設定します。 numpyモジュールが使われています。
numpy.pi
表示πnumpy.arange( 0 , 2π ,0.01)
0 から 2π まで 0.01 刻み。
Ling
x=numpy.arange( 0, 2*numpy.pi, 0.01) y=numpy.sin(x)
絵を描くには、matplotlib.pyplotモジュールのplotメソッドを使用する必要があります。
plot(x,y) pyplot.plot.show()
完全なコードは次のとおりです:
import numpy as np import matplotlib.pyplot as plt x=np.arange(0,2*np.pi,0.01) y=np.sin(x) plt.plot(x,y) plt.show()
この写真が少し単調な場合は、何かを追加して装飾できます。
plt.xlabel("x軸ラベル")
plt.ylabel("y軸ラベル")
plt.title("画像タイトル")
plt.xlim(0,5) 描画したグラフから選択x 範囲内のグラフィックフラグメント。
plt.ylim(0,5) y フラグメント
plt.plot(x,y,linewidth=4) 線の幅を設定します
plt.plot(x,y,"gcharacter") g は緑色の後ろの文字を表します線の種類を表現します。点線、点線など
{y: yellow b: black c:gray Default is blue}
Character-Type
y1=sin(x) y2=cos(x)
同じ写真
plt.plot(x1,y1,x2,y2)
関連する推奨事項:
js を使用して sinusoids を描画する_javascript スキル
JavaScript での逆正弦関数 Math.asin() の使用方法の紹介_基礎知識
CSS3 を使用して湾曲したシャドウとエッジワーピングを実装するグラフィック コードのチュートリアル
以上がPythonの正弦曲線実装方法の解析の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。